CHOCOLATE-DIPPED SPOONS
Coffee goes down in the most delightful way when stirred with these sugar-coated spoons created by our Test Kitchen. They lend a hint of raspberry to your favorite warm drinks.
Provided by Taste of Home
Time 20m
Yield 1 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- In a microwave-safe bowl, melt chocolate chips and 1 teaspoon shortening; stir until smooth. Dip each spoon into chocolate; tap spoon handles on edge of bowl to remove excess chocolate. Place on waxed paper; let stand until set., In a microwave-safe bowl, melt semisweet chocolate and remaining shortening; stir until smooth. Dip coated spoons into chocolate mixture; tap spoon handles on edge of bowl to remove excess chocolate. Place on waxed paper; sprinkle with coarse sugar. Let stand until set.

HOT CHOCOLATE SPOONS
Provided by Jasmine Smith
Time 35m
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Place semisweet chocolate and bittersweet chocolate in a microwavable bowl. Microwave on HIGH 30 seconds. Stir well, and repeat for 30-second intervals until chocolate is completely melted and smooth, about 4 more times. (Note: If only a few lumps remain in the melted chocolate, microwave 15 seconds.) Stir vanilla into chocolate mixture until combined. Immediately spoon chocolate mixture evenly (about 1 1/2 tablespoons) into a 12- to 15-compartment silicone ice cube tray.
- Let chocolate cool slightly, about 5 minutes. Sprinkle with desired toppings, and insert a plastic spoon into center of each compartment. Freeze until chocolate hardens and is completely set, 15 to 20 minutes. Remove from silicone ice tray.
CHOCOLATE SPOONS
Use your creativity to decorate these beautiful chocolate-covered spoons that make a delightful holiday gift - ready in just 35 minutes.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Dessert
Time 35m
Yield 18
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Line cookie sheet with waxed paper. In heavy 1-quart saucepan, melt chocolate chips over lowest possible heat, stirring constantly.
- Tip saucepan so chocolate runs to one side. Dip bowl portion of each spoon into chocolate. Sprinkle with candy decorations. Place on waxed paper. Let stand about 10 minutes or until chocolate is dry.
- Wrap spoons in plastic wrap or cellophane.

CHOCOLATE-DIPPED BEVERAGE SPOONS
These make a cute gift when wrapped individually in cellophane, tied with colorful ribbon and displayed in a Christmas mug. To set the chocolate quickly, chill dipped spoons in the freezer. -Marcy Boswell, Menifee, California
Provided by Taste of Home
Time 45m
Yield 2 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- In a microwave-safe bowl, melt milk chocolate chips with 2 teaspoons shortening; stir until smooth. Repeat with white baking chips and remaining shortening. Dip spoons into either mixture, tapping handles on bowl edges to remove excess. Place on a waxed paper-lined baking sheet. Pipe or drizzle milk chocolate over white-dipped spoons and white mixture over milk chocolate-dipped spoons. Use a toothpick or skewer to swirl chocolate. If desired, decorate with coarse sugar or sprinkles if desired. Chill for 5 minutes or until set. Use as stirring spoons for coffee or cocoa.

CHOCOLATE SPOONS
These chocolate-covered spoons make delightful holiday gifts. They are so wonderful to have at home, too. Use them to stir a little chocolate into your coffee, or strengthen your hot chocolate. You will need 20 to 24 plastic spoons for this recipe.
Provided by Michele Streichert
Categories Desserts Chocolate Dessert Recipes Milk Chocolate
Yield 24
Number Of Ingredients 2
Steps:
- In a microwave safe bowl, melt semisweet chocolate pieces in microwave for 2 to 3 minutes and stir until smooth. Dip spoons into chocolate. Put spoons onto wax paper and refrigerate until chocolate hardens.
- Melt milk chocolate pieces in microwave for 2 to 3 minutes and stir until smooth. Place chocolate into plastic bag and cut off a corner. Drizzle melted chocolate over spoons. Refrigerate until chocolate hardens.
- Wrap each spoon separately and store in a cool dry place,

HOT CHOCOLATE STIRRERS
We all know a few die hard chocolate fans - make them one of these hot choc stirrers as a gift and they'll never want to use powdered cocoa again
Provided by Miriam Nice
Categories Treat
Time 13m
Yield makes 6
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- You will need:6 cupcake cases, pencil, pastry brush, 6 empty 47g fromage frais pots (washed and dried), 6 wooden lolly sticks, cellophane and string or ribbon for wrapping, 6 gift tagsPush a small hole in the middle of the cupcake cases with a pencil and put aside for later.
- Dip the pastry brush in the sunflower oil and paint a very thin layer of oil over the insides of the fromage frais pots.
- Put the chocolate in a bowl and heat in the microwave in 30-sec bursts until runny, stirring after each blast. Or melt it in a heatproof bowl set over a pan of simmering water (get an adult to help you). If you're using different types of chocolate, you should melt them separately.
- Carefully pour the melted chocolate into the pots. Put a lolly stick in the middle of each and sprinkle your chosen decorations around it.
- Sit a cake case on top of each pot so that it covers the chocolate and the stick pokes through the hole. Put them in the fridge to set overnight.
- The next day, carefully pull the chocolates out of the pots and throw away the paper cases. Wrap each in cellophane tied with string and write a tag to read: 'Simply stir into hot milk.'
